Maven SCM
  1. Maven SCM
  2. SCM-678

scm perforce: mvn release:prepare fails with IOException and a write error (Access is denied)

    Details

    • Type: Bug Bug
    • Status: Closed
    • Priority: Major Major
    • Resolution: Fixed
    • Affects Version/s: 1.7
    • Fix Version/s: 1.8
    • Labels:
      None
    • Environment:
      Windows 7 both command prompt and cygwin using Perforce for SCM

      Description

      When running

      mvn release:prepare -Dusername=<perforce_user> -Dpassword=<perforce_password>

      I get the errors:

      • java.io.IOException: The filename, directory name, or volume label syntax is incorrect
      • [ERROR] CommandLineException Exit code: 1 - Usage: add/edit/delete [-c changelist#] [ -d -f -k -n -v ] [-t type] files...
        Missing/wrong number of arguments.
      • [ERROR] Failed to execute goal org.apache.maven.plugins:maven-release-plugin:2.3.1:prepare (default-cli) on project root-project: Error writing POM: D:\Server\pom.xml (Access is denied) -> [Help 1]

      The full output is attached.

      Sometimes I also get the error:

      • [ERROR] D:\Server\pom.xml - file(s) not in client view.

      Though I created the client in the same location I'm running from, and I'm not sure that error is related to the others (as the others also occur when that one doesn't).

      It's been suggested (on stackoverflow: http://stackoverflow.com/questions/10999403/maven-releaseprepare-ioexception) that the error has to do with my D drive being a mapped drive, though I don't think it is as it's not listed if I run subst. However, I think it must be at least a partition on the same hard drive, unless my PC has three physical drives (work PC), but I guess that shouldn't make any difference to the program?

      1. maven-release-error.txt
        11 kB
        Robert Scholte
      2. MNG-678-perforce.patch
        12 kB
        Svend Hansen
      3. mvn_release_output_x_client_env.txt
        39 kB
        Robert Scholte
      4. mvn_release_output_x.txt
        39 kB
        Robert Scholte

        Issue Links

          Activity

          No work has yet been logged on this issue.

            People

            • Assignee:
              Olivier Lamy (*$^¨%`£)
              Reporter:
              Robert Scholte
            • Votes:
              0 Vote for this issue
              Watchers:
              3 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ved:

                Development